2 Neutron Curtain in the HTR. A 6 ft 6 in. square sheet of -in.-thick boral mounted in an aluminum frame will serve as the neutron curtain. This curtain will be used during operation, if desired, to cover the face of the thermal column and reduce the number of thermal neutrons entering the column. It will have rollers at its four corners that will travel in vertical guides mounted in the 3-in. space between the two 4-in. thermal shield plates. [Pg.79]

A 2-in. by 7-ft vertical slot in the biological shield from the bottom of the thermal. shield to the sub-pile room ceiling will house the curtain when it is not in use. To shield against radiation streaming, the lower portion of this slot- will be filled with 2-ft-deep removable barytes concrete blocks supported from the sub-pile room ceiling by 6-in.-square steel bars which serve as additional shielding. [Pg.79]

A lifting mechanism mounted on the top of the reactor structure raises or lowers the curtain as desired. After removing the concrete and steel shielding at the bottom of the curtain slot, the curtain can. be lowered into the canal and a new curtain installed if necessary. [Pg.79]

Provisions have also been made for installation of a curtain on the west side of the thermal shield at the. face of the shielding facility however, no curtain or lifting mechanism will be furnished initially. [Pg.79]

3 The Neutron Window. The neutron window is a 3-in. sheet of lead placed between the permanent graphite and the thermal column to absorb gamma radiation but permit easy neutron passage. The lead sheet is mounted in a steel frame and pl aced in the approximately 6- by 6-ft hole in the outer thermal shield. [Pg.79]


Two important experimental facilities, the thermal column and the shielding facility (see Sections 3.1 and, 3.2j, require that a section approximately 6 by 6 ft be removed from.the east and west thermal-shield side plates. Two components are added to the thermal-shield design by.these facilities (1) the neutron window, and (2) the neutron-absorbing curtain.
